Gravitational Field
What is the gravitational acceleration of objects inside of the International Space Station.
G=6.67x10-11 Nm2/kg?
MEarth=5.97 x1024 kg
Mspace Station=420,000 kg
REarth= 6370 km
Distance from Earth's surface to the space station = 400 km
m/s2
